Regarding the brakes, yes a disc set up would be best, but for now a good servo will do.
The P5 axle has bigger drums than a Commer, so that,s the rear sorted.
The Rover engine weighs less than a 1725, which also helps.
Most of the time it will be traveling at normal speeds anyway, just getting there quicker

Yes, we need to do something to lower the intake temps, as it will be in a very dangerous zone with the 9.35 compression and serious boost with no intercooler.
Close to detonation levels, and the last thing you want is blown pistons after all this work. Shame it,s a bit costly, but much cheaper than blown pistons

Progress report
Exhaust manifolds done, all made from a nice bit of 316 marine stainless, not the normal cheapo 304 grade [^]
Not ideal from a gas flow point, but the best way considering the space available [}]
